Of those municipalities of over 10,000 inhabitants, the ones on the left bank of the Nervión continued to have a high percentage of people out of work, despite the drastic reduction in numbers: Sestao went from 36% in 1996 to 19.3% in 2001, Erandio went from 31.4% to16.2%, Santurtzi from 31.6% to 16.2% and Barakaldo from 29.8% to 14.8%. The three capitals also halved their unemployment rates, although Bilbao continued to be the worst-affected by this phenomena: it went from 26.8% in 1996 to 14.8% in 2001, Donostia-San Sebastián from 22.5% to 11.4%, and Vitoria-Gasteiz, showing the most favourable results, went from 18.8% to 9.7%.
